ANI string (60#)
Up to 10 digits ANI can be programmed in the model 4700VP (only characters 0 ~ 9 will be accepted, 3 or more
digits recommended). With no ANI programmed, the default connect code is a single star (*) and single pound (#)
for disconnect.
Example: To program the 4700VP for connect code *123 enter the following sequence: 60# 123#
Toll Restrict Override Code (61#)
The Toll Restrict Override Code will give privileged users the ability to bypass the toll restriction table. The code
can be programmed for up to 10 digits string. This code must be different from ANI and other control codes.
Example: To program the toll override code to *1234 enter the following sequence: 61# 1234#
Remote Programming Code (62#)
The 4700VP can be programmed easily over the air by use of a Remote Programming code. The factory default for
this code is zero length. This means that a code must be programmed into the 4700VP when setting up the
interconnect (only characters 0 through 9 will be accepted). To enter the remote programming mode, the remote
programming code must be sent within 2 seconds after receiving the connect code. If no digits are received within 30
seconds of each other once a command has began, the last command entered will be aborted. Program mode aborts
after 2 minutes of no activity.
Example: To program the remote code of *4321 enter the following sequence: 62# 4321#
Speed Dial Remote Program Code (63#)
This code will allow the mobile operator to program the speed dial locations over the air. This code must also be
sent within 2 seconds after receiving the connect code (only the speed dial locations will be accessible through this
code).
Example: To program the speed dial locations to *1212 enter the following sequence: 63# 1212#
CW ID Call Letters (64#)
Up to 15 characters can be programmed into the 4700VP as a station ID. Each character is entered with a 2 digit
code as shown below.
